From: Chris Wilson Date: Fri, 11 May 2018 12:11:47 +0000 (+0100) Subject: drm/i915/execlists: Relax CSB force-mmio for VT-d X-Git-Tag: v4.18-rc1~16^2~17^2~2 X-Git-Url: http://git.osdn.net/view?a=commitdiff_plain;h=4db518e4e8286ca93bd5399f26549eafc87607ea;p=uclinux-h8%2Flinux.git drm/i915/execlists: Relax CSB force-mmio for VT-d The original switch to use CSB from the HWSP was plagued by the effect of read ordering on VT-d; we would read the WRITE pointer from the HWSP before it had completed writing the CSB contents. The mystery comes down to the lack of rmb() for correct ordering with respect to the writes from HW, and with that resolved we can remove the VT-d special casing.
